Alternative Scene Objective: SWBAT utilize the knowledge they have compiled throughout their study of The Crucible and analysis of group conformity in order to construct an alternative scene for The Cruciblethat demonstrates the character traits of three characters and reveals how group conformity is either rejected or accepted by each of the three characters. While viewing the skit performances, SWBAT write reflections on the scene their group constructed as well as the scenes constructed by their peers. Why are we doing this? 1. This assignment allows you to independently and critically explore and engage the text to demonstrate to the instructor what you have learned. 2. It will give you a deeper understanding of the text and group conformity. 3. It should also be fun!

Alternative Scene Project #1 – Get in your groups. #2 – Pick your scenario from the bowl as I come around the room. #3 – Take five minutes to analyze your three/four character’s psychology using their dialogue from The Crucible as a guide. (5 minutes) #4 – Create a script (approximately 1 pg.) to be turned in at the beginning of the next class. (about 35minutes) #5 – Perform your skit and write a reflection of your peer’s skits. #6 - Answer the two questions on the bottom of your handout to turn in at the end of the period. Follow the directions on the handout!!!!!

  6. Scene Presentations Provide a copy of your script to the instructor. For each group, write a piece of paper that lists the names of the people in the group and answers the three questions on the next slide…

  7. Scene Observations #1 – Based on your understanding of the characters from The Crucible, did the group’s characterization of each character make sense? Identify each character portrayed and give at least one reason as to how the character was or was not accurately portrayed. #2 – How was group conformity presented in the group’s scene? #3 – Could this scene have been included in The Crucible? Why or why not?
